اقرأ أكثرA performance model for impact crushers
Abstract. In this paper we develop a performance model for impact crushers. The product size distribution is obtained as a function of the crusher's rotor radius and angular velocity, the feed rate and the feed size distribution. The model is based on the standard matrix formulation that includes classification and breakage matrices.Web

اقرأ أكثرTypes of Hammer Mills Explained
A Hammer mill is a crusher that can be considered as a primary, secondary or tertiary type hammer mill. This availability allows for a wide range of uses. The final size of the product depends on a few factors of the hammer mill's design, such as: The rotor speed; The hammer configuration; The grinding plate's setting; The material being crushedWeb

اقرأ أكثرTECHNICAL NOTES 5 CRUSHERS
The gape determines the maximum size of material that can be accepted. Maximum size that can be accepted into the crusher is approximately 80% of the gape. Jaw crushers are operated to produce a size reduction ratio between 4:1 and 9:1. Gyratory crushers can produce size reduction ratios over a somewhat larger range of 3:1 to 10:1.Web

اقرأ أكثرHow does an impact crusher work? | RUBBLE MASTER
Once the hammer hits the big material entering the crusher box it is thrown against the wall and starts ricocheting between hammers, wall and other material particles. As soon as the material is small enough the fit in between the rotor and the lowest crushing stage of the impact wall it will leave the crusher box at the bottom.Web
